2017-10-17 13 views
1

Je viens de générer des clés ssh dans mon Git Bash pour une application que je veux pousser vers GitHub. J'ai ajouté l'identité de l'agent et de l'agent, copié la clé et créé une nouvelle clé SSH dans mon compte GitHub. Quand j'essaye de courir $ssh -T [email protected] j'obtiens un message d'erreur qui indique "ssh_exchange_identification: read: Connection reset by peer". J'ai déjà vu cela posé avant, mais pas directement par rapport à GitHub (corrigez-moi si je me trompe). Je vois mes fichiers id_ras et id_rsa.pub dans mon dossier User \ .ssh. Quel pourrait être le problème causant ce message d'erreur? Note: Je cours ceci dans mon bureau et je me demande si cela pourrait être provoqué par le pare-feu de réseau de bureau?Erreur GitHub - "ssh_exchange_identification: read: Connexion réinitialisée par l'homologue"

+0

Commander cette réponse https://unix.stackexchange.com/questions/151860/ssh-exchange-identification-read-connection-reset-by-peer, qui semble être similaire à votre problème –

Répondre

2

Première ssh -T [email protected] ne fonctionnerait pas
ssh -T [email protected] serait

Deuxièmement, si vous avez un proxy/pare-feu dans votre bureau, connexion ssh sortant doit être bloqué.
L'utilisation d'une URL https (avec mise en cache des informations d'identification) est votre meilleure option.

+0

Vous avez raison, que était une faute de frappe. Et vous avez également raison de dire que c'était en fait le pare-feu du réseau. Quand je suis rentré chez moi et que j'ai exécuté la même commande, ça a fonctionné parfaitement. Je me doutais que c'était le cas. – jcbridwe